Contact Lenses for Astigmatism

Toric Lenses 

Toric lenses are specially designed for people with astigmatism and provide better vision than standard contacts. These lenses are thicker at the bottom, which helps counteract the irregular shape of your cornea and provides clear vision.

They’re also made from a material that holds their shape well, so they stay in place on your eye instead of rotating or slipping out of position. Toric lenses are comfortable and easy to care for.

Multifocal Lenses

Multifocal lenses are designed to correct both nearsightedness and farsightedness while also addressing astigmatism. In addition, they also correct presbyopia, the gradual loss of close-up vision that happens as we age, so multifocal lenses are an excellent choice for those who need more than one corrective solution in their contacts. Like toric lenses, multifocal lenses are also comfortable and easy to care for.

Hybrid Lenses

Hybrid lenses offer the best of both worlds: the crisp vision correction provided by rigid gas permeable (RGP) lenses combined with the comfort and easy wear-ability of soft lenses. Like toric lenses, hybrid lenses are designed to hold their shape well and won’t rotate or slip out of position on your eyes as regular soft contacts do.

For those who need a combination of prescription strengths for different parts of their eyes, hybrid lenses can provide a great solution that offers both comfort and clarity.
